Message ID | 20231228085748.1083901-2-willy@infradead.org (mailing list archive) |
---|---|
State | New |
Headers | show |
Series | Remove some lruvec page accounting functions | expand |
On 12/28/23 09:57, Matthew Wilcox (Oracle) wrote: > All callers of these have been converted to their folio equivalents. > > Signed-off-by: Matthew Wilcox (Oracle) <willy@infradead.org> Reviewed-by: Vlastimil Babka <vbabka@suse.cz> > --- > include/linux/vmstat.h | 24 ------------------------ > 1 file changed, 24 deletions(-) > > diff --git a/include/linux/vmstat.h b/include/linux/vmstat.h > index fed855bae6d8..147ae73e0ee7 100644 > --- a/include/linux/vmstat.h > +++ b/include/linux/vmstat.h > @@ -597,18 +597,6 @@ static inline void mod_lruvec_page_state(struct page *page, > > #endif /* CONFIG_MEMCG */ > > -static inline void __inc_lruvec_page_state(struct page *page, > - enum node_stat_item idx) > -{ > - __mod_lruvec_page_state(page, idx, 1); > -} > - > -static inline void __dec_lruvec_page_state(struct page *page, > - enum node_stat_item idx) > -{ > - __mod_lruvec_page_state(page, idx, -1); > -} > - > static inline void __lruvec_stat_mod_folio(struct folio *folio, > enum node_stat_item idx, int val) > { > @@ -627,18 +615,6 @@ static inline void __lruvec_stat_sub_folio(struct folio *folio, > __lruvec_stat_mod_folio(folio, idx, -folio_nr_pages(folio)); > } > > -static inline void inc_lruvec_page_state(struct page *page, > - enum node_stat_item idx) > -{ > - mod_lruvec_page_state(page, idx, 1); > -} > - > -static inline void dec_lruvec_page_state(struct page *page, > - enum node_stat_item idx) > -{ > - mod_lruvec_page_state(page, idx, -1); > -} > - > static inline void lruvec_stat_mod_folio(struct folio *folio, > enum node_stat_item idx, int val) > {
diff --git a/include/linux/vmstat.h b/include/linux/vmstat.h index fed855bae6d8..147ae73e0ee7 100644 --- a/include/linux/vmstat.h +++ b/include/linux/vmstat.h @@ -597,18 +597,6 @@ static inline void mod_lruvec_page_state(struct page *page, #endif /* CONFIG_MEMCG */ -static inline void __inc_lruvec_page_state(struct page *page, - enum node_stat_item idx) -{ - __mod_lruvec_page_state(page, idx, 1); -} - -static inline void __dec_lruvec_page_state(struct page *page, - enum node_stat_item idx) -{ - __mod_lruvec_page_state(page, idx, -1); -} - static inline void __lruvec_stat_mod_folio(struct folio *folio, enum node_stat_item idx, int val) { @@ -627,18 +615,6 @@ static inline void __lruvec_stat_sub_folio(struct folio *folio, __lruvec_stat_mod_folio(folio, idx, -folio_nr_pages(folio)); } -static inline void inc_lruvec_page_state(struct page *page, - enum node_stat_item idx) -{ - mod_lruvec_page_state(page, idx, 1); -} - -static inline void dec_lruvec_page_state(struct page *page, - enum node_stat_item idx) -{ - mod_lruvec_page_state(page, idx, -1); -} - static inline void lruvec_stat_mod_folio(struct folio *folio, enum node_stat_item idx, int val) {
All callers of these have been converted to their folio equivalents. Signed-off-by: Matthew Wilcox (Oracle) <willy@infradead.org> --- include/linux/vmstat.h | 24 ------------------------ 1 file changed, 24 deletions(-)